Under flows refer to the movement of water, liquid, or other substances beneath a surface. It is an important natural phenomenon that is studied by scientists to understand the flow of underground water. The synonyms for under flows include seepage, percolation, infiltration, osmosis, and subterranean flow. These terms describe the movement of fluids that are below a surface and are essential for understanding the hydrology of an area. Under flows are important in agriculture, geology, and environmental science, as they can affect groundwater levels, land stability, and biodiversity. Understanding the synonyms for under flows can help researchers and scientists communicate more effectively about this important natural phenomenon.
